Going ANG after 2 year break in service, trying to reclass? https://www.rallypoint.com/answers/going-ang-after-2-year-break-in-service-trying-to-reclass <div class="images-v2-count-0"></div>I’m prior service Active Army, considering going National Guard. I’m thinking about changing my MOS to 31B MP. Anybody have any insight on how long the schooling would be/where it would be? Not sure if it matters, but I’m from NJ. CPL Michael Peck Wed, 03 Oct 2018 13:54:02 -0400 2018-10-03T13:54:02-04:00 Response by 1SG Wendy Dorner made Oct 3 at 2018 4:22 PM https://www.rallypoint.com/answers/going-ang-after-2-year-break-in-service-trying-to-reclass?n=4016299&urlhash=4016299 <div class="images-v2-count-0"></div>If you’re joining the NG and then reclassing, you won’t go to Leonardwood but would do two- two week phases of MP school at whatever RTI your state can get you into. There are schools in multiple states and they run classes at different times. The best way to do it is both at the same time but if you can’t do that you can go to each phase separately. 1SG Wendy Dorner Wed, 03 Oct 2018 16:22:07 -0400 2018-10-03T16:22:07-04:00 2018-10-02T19:13:00-04:00
